The branch, eden has been updated
       via  21e7cc718d4f75fdcfaada4afa69c75299ad5e10 (commit)
      from  2026042e79ed5fe22ceb85b0952ec27145ddab3b (commit)

- Log -----------------------------------------------------------------
http://xbmc.git.sourceforge.net/git/gitweb.cgi?p=xbmc/scrapers;a=commit;h=21e7cc718d4f75fdcfaada4afa69c75299ad5e10

commit 21e7cc718d4f75fdcfaada4afa69c75299ad5e10
Author: olympia <[email protected]>
Date:   Sat May 19 13:42:06 2012 +0200

    [metadata.universal] updated to version 1.1.0
    [metadata.common.trakt.tv] added initial version

diff --git a/metadata.universal/addon.xml b/metadata.universal/addon.xml
index 4ea42e5..65bcf8b 100644
--- a/metadata.universal/addon.xml
+++ b/metadata.universal/addon.xml
@@ -1,7 +1,7 @@
 <?xml version="1.0" encoding="UTF-8" standalone="yes"?>
 <addon id="metadata.universal"
        name="Universal Scraper"
-       version="1.0.5"
+       version="1.1.0"
        provider-name="Olympia, Team XBMC">
   <requires>
     <import addon="xbmc.metadata" version="1.0"/>
@@ -13,6 +13,7 @@
     <import addon="metadata.common.youtubetrailers" version="1.0.4"/>
     <import addon="metadata.common.rt.com" version="1.3.0"/>
     <import addon="metadata.common.ofdb.de" version="1.0.0"/>
+    <import addon="metadata.common.trakt.tv" version="1.0.0"/>
   </requires>
   <extension point="xbmc.metadata.scraper.movies"
              language="en"
diff --git a/metadata.universal/changelog.txt b/metadata.universal/changelog.txt
index 2a38e3e..fabcb15 100644
--- a/metadata.universal/changelog.txt
+++ b/metadata.universal/changelog.txt
@@ -1,3 +1,6 @@
+[B]1.1.0[/B]
+- added: support for trakt.tv
+
 [B]1.0.5[/B]
 - added: some improvement to match movies by their International Titles
 
diff --git a/metadata.universal/resources/language/English/strings.xml 
b/metadata.universal/resources/language/English/strings.xml
index 696b836..63aa683 100644
--- a/metadata.universal/resources/language/English/strings.xml
+++ b/metadata.universal/resources/language/English/strings.xml
@@ -30,6 +30,9 @@
     <string id="30034">     Preferred Thumb Language</string>
     <string id="30035">Certification Prefix</string>
     <string id="30036">Enable posters from IMDb</string>
+    <string id="30037">Enable posters from trakt.tv</string>
+    <string id="30038">Enable fanart from trakt.tv</string>
+    <string id="30039">Enable trailers from trakt.tv</string>
 
     <string id="30100">Rating</string>
     <string id="30021">Get Ratings from</string>
diff --git a/metadata.universal/resources/settings.xml 
b/metadata.universal/resources/settings.xml
index 1e1bbfd..e6ee5a1 100644
--- a/metadata.universal/resources/settings.xml
+++ b/metadata.universal/resources/settings.xml
@@ -6,24 +6,26 @@
       <setting label="30008" type="labelenum" values="Keep Original|USA / 
International|Argentina|Austria|Belgium|Brazil|Bulgaria|Canada|China|Colombia|Chile|Croatia|Czech
 Republic|Denmark|Finland|France|Germany|Greece|Hong 
Kong|Hungary|Iceland|India|Israel|Italy|Japan|Mexico|Netherlands|Norway|Pakistan|Poland|Portugal|Romania|Russia|Serbia|Singapore|Slovenia|Spain|Sweden|Switzerland|Thailand|Turkey|Uruguay|Venezuela"
 id="imdbakatitles" default="Keep Original" visible="eq(-1,0)"/>
       <setting label="30027" type="labelenum" 
values="da|fi|nl|de|it|es|fr|pl|hu|el|tr|ru|he|ja|pt|zh|cs|sl|hr|ko|en|sv|no" 
id="tmdbtitlelanguage" default="en" visible="eq(-2,1)"/>
     <setting type="lsep" label="30016"/>
-      <setting label="30014" type="labelenum" 
values="IMDb|themoviedb.org|Rotten Tomatoes|OFDb.de" id="plotsource" 
default="IMDb"/>
+      <setting label="30014" type="labelenum" 
values="IMDb|themoviedb.org|Rotten Tomatoes|trakt.tv|OFDb.de" id="plotsource" 
default="IMDb"/>
       <setting label="30020" type="labelenum" 
values="da|fi|nl|de|it|es|fr|pl|hu|el|tr|ru|he|ja|pt|zh|cs|sl|hr|ko|en|sv|no" 
id="tmdbplotlanguage" default="en" visible="eq(-1,1)"/>
     <setting label="30025" type="lsep"/>
       <setting label="30015" type="labelenum" 
values="IMDb|IMDbFull|themoviedb.org" id="creditssource" default="IMDb"/>
     <setting label="30026" type="lsep"/>
-      <setting label="30022" type="labelenum" values="IMDb|themoviedb.org" 
id="genressource" default="IMDb"/>
+      <setting label="30022" type="labelenum" 
values="IMDb|themoviedb.org|trakt.tv" id="genressource" default="IMDb"/>
     <setting label="30029" type="lsep"/>
       <setting label="30013" type="bool" id="tmdbset" default="true"/>
   </category>
 
   <category label="30011">
     <setting type="lsep" label="Poster Sources"/>
+    <setting label="30037" type="bool" id="trakttvposter" default="false"/>
     <setting label="30002" type="bool" id="tmdbthumbs" default="true"/>
     <setting label="30034" type="labelenum" 
values="da|fi|nl|de|it|es|fr|pl|hu|el|tr|ru|he|ja|pt|zh|cs|sl|hr|ko|en|sv|no" 
id="tmdbthumblanguage" default="en" enable="!eq(-1,false)"/>
     <setting label="30003" type="bool" id="impawards" default="false"/>
     <setting label="30004" type="bool" id="movieposterdb" default="false"/>
     <setting label="30036" type="bool" id="imdbthumbs" default="false"/>
     <setting type="lsep" label="Fanart Sources"/>
+    <setting label="30038" type="bool" id="trakttvfanart" default="false"/>
     <setting label="30001" type="bool" id="fanart" default="true"/>
   </category>
 
@@ -31,12 +33,13 @@
     <setting label="30028" type="lsep"/>
     <setting label="30006" type="labelenum" values="No|480p|720p|1080p" 
id="TrailerQ" default="No"/>
     <setting label="30009" type="bool" id="tmdbtrailer" default="true"/>
+    <setting label="30039" type="bool" id="trakttvtrailer" default="false"/>
     <setting label="30005" type="bool" id="ytrailer" default="false"/>
   </category>
 
   <category label="30100">
     <setting type="lsep" label="30030"/>
-    <setting label="30021" type="labelenum" values="IMDb|Rotten 
Tomatoes|themoviedb.org" id="mratingsource" default="IMDb"/>
+    <setting label="30021" type="labelenum" values="IMDb|Rotten 
Tomatoes|themoviedb.org|trakt.tv" id="mratingsource" default="IMDb"/>
       <setting label="30120" type="bool" id="rtoutline" default="false" 
visible="eq(-1,1)"/>
       <setting label="30110" type="labelenum" values="TomatoMeter|Average 
Rating" id="tomato" default="TomatoMeter" visible="eq(-2,1)"/>
       <setting label="30115" type="labelenum" values="All Critics|Top Critics" 
id="allcritics" default="All Critics" visible="eq(-3,1)"/>
diff --git a/metadata.universal/universal.xml b/metadata.universal/universal.xml
index b19069e..a728b28 100644
--- a/metadata.universal/universal.xml
+++ b/metadata.universal/universal.xml
@@ -80,12 +80,18 @@
                        <RegExp input="$INFO[mratingsource]" output="&lt;chain 
function=&quot;GetTMDBRatingBy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ression>themoviedb.org</expression>
                        </RegExp>
+                       <RegExp input="$INFO[mratingsource]" output="&lt;chain 
function=&quot;GetTRAKTTVRatingBy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
+                               <expression>trakt.tv</expression>
+                       </RegExp>
                        <RegExp input="$INFO[genressource]" output="&lt;chain 
function=&quot;GetIMDBGenresById&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ression>IMDb</expression>
                        </RegExp>
                        <RegExp input="$INFO[genressource]" output="&lt;chain 
function=&quot;GetTMDBGenresBy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ression>themoviedb.org</expression>
                        </RegExp>
+                       <RegExp input="$INFO[genressource]" output="&lt;chain 
function=&quot;GetTRAKTTVGenresBy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
+                               <expression>trakt.tv</expression>
+                       </RegExp>
                        <RegExp input="$$1" 
output="&lt;country&gt;\1&lt;/country&gt;" dest="5+">
                                <expression 
repeat="yes">"/country/[^&gt;]+&gt;([^&lt;]+)&lt;/a&gt;</expression>
                        </RegExp>
@@ -110,6 +116,9 @@
                        <RegExp input="$INFO[plotsource]" output="&lt;chain 
function=&quot;GetOFDbPlotByIMDBId&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ression>OFDb.de</expression>
                        </RegExp>
+                       <RegExp input="$INFO[plotsource]" output="&lt;chain 
function=&quot;GetTRAKTTVPlotBy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
+                               <expression>trakt.tv</expression>
+                       </RegExp>
                        <RegExp input="$INFO[creditssource]" output="&lt;chain 
function=&quot;GetIMDBCastById&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ression>IMDb</expression>
                        </RegExp>
@@ -140,6 +149,9 @@
                        <RegExp conditional="tmdbset" input="$$2" 
output="&lt;chain 
function=&quot;GetTMDBSetBy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ression />
                        </RegExp>
+                       <RegExp conditional="trakttvposter" input="$$2" 
output="&lt;chain 
function=&quot;GetTRAKTTVThumbsBy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
+                               <expression/>
+                       </RegExp>
                        <RegExp conditional="tmdbthumbs" input="$$2" 
output="&lt;chain 
function=&quot;GetTMDBLangThumbsBy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ression/>
                        </RegExp>
@@ -149,6 +161,9 @@
                        <RegExp conditional="movieposterdb" input="$$2" 
output="&lt;chain 
function=&quot;GetMoviePosterDBThumbs&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ression/>
                        </RegExp>
+                       <RegExp conditional="trakttvfanart" input="$$2" 
output="&lt;chain 
function=&quot;GetTRAKTTVFanartBy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
+                               <expression/>
+                       </RegExp>
                        <RegExp conditional="fanart" input="$$2" 
output="&lt;chain 
function=&quot;GetTMDBFanartBy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ression/>
                        </RegExp>
@@ -164,6 +179,9 @@
                        <RegExp conditional="tmdbtrailer" input="$$2" 
output="&lt;chain 
function=&quot;GetTMDBTrailerBy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
                                <expression/>
                        </RegExp>
+                       <RegExp conditional="trakttvtrailer" input="$$2" 
output="&lt;chain 
function=&quot;GetTRAKTTVTrailerByIdChain&quot;&gt;$$2&lt;/chain&gt;" dest="5+">
+                               <expression/>
+                       </RegExp>
                        <RegExp input="$INFO[TrailerQ]" output="&lt;chain 
function=&quot;GetHDTrailersnet480p&quot;&gt;$$6&lt;/chain&gt;" dest="5+">
                                <RegExp input="$$1" output="\1" dest="6">
                                        <expression>&lt;meta 
name=&quot;title&quot; 
content=&quot;(?:&amp;#x22;)?([^&quot;]*?)(?:&amp;#x22;)? 
\([^\(]*?([0-9]{4})\)</expression>

-----------------------------------------------------------------------

Summary of changes:
 metadata.common.trakt.tv/addon.xml                 |   41 +++++++
 metadata.common.trakt.tv/trakttv.xml               |  120 ++++++++++++++++++++
 metadata.universal/addon.xml                       |    3 +-
 metadata.universal/changelog.txt                   |    3 +
 .../resources/language/English/strings.xml         |    3 +
 metadata.universal/resources/settings.xml          |    9 +-
 metadata.universal/universal.xml                   |   18 +++
 7 files changed, 193 insertions(+), 4 deletions(-)
 create mode 100644 metadata.common.trakt.tv/addon.xml
 create mode 100644 metadata.common.trakt.tv/trakttv.xml


hooks/post-receive
-- 
Scrapers

------------------------------------------------------------------------------
Live Security Virtual Conference
Exclusive live event will cover all the ways today's security and 
threat landscape has changed and how IT managers can respond. Discussions 
will include endpoint security, mobile security and the latest in malware 
threats. http://www.accelacomm.com/jaw/sfrnl04242012/114/50122263/
_______________________________________________
Xbmc-addons m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/xbmc-addons

Reply via email to